1. eversleeping's Avatar
    I have one Blackberry 8900 with MEP code "0" left (no chance to enter MEP code), if any ways to unlock it ( not by hardware)?

    One more, if any software or solutions to clear blackberry phone voice/data usage to "0.0" ?
    05-19-10 11:32 AM
  2. amazinglygraceless's Avatar
    If you are at zero for unlock attempts it's game over. There is no resetting the
    counter. The phone will be permanently locked to the carrier that the phone is
    branded to.

  7. Branta's Avatar
    The best approach is probably to be honest to potential buyers, and indicate the 2.5 minutes as test or demo time.

    There is no way to reset the time and data counters using publicly available tools. It may be possible for an approved reconditioning workshop, but they are very scarce and the phone would be "Reconditioned" which is probably worse for selling it.
